

In 500 B.C., during Chinas famed 'Spring and Autumn Period', Kong Ze (Confucius), a commoner reverred for his outstanding wisdom, is made Minister of Law in the ancient Kingdom of Lu. Under his inspired leadership, Lu ascends to new heights but becomes a target of conquest for the warlike nation of…
Confucius (2010) is a drama and history film directed by Hu Mei. It stars Chow Yun-Fat, Zhou Xun, and Wang Ban. The film runs for 2 hours 5 minutes. Audiences have made it a mixed pick, with an average score of 6.0 out of 10 from 114 votes.
